A city centre restaurant has been fined £14,000 after inspectors found an infestation of mice in the kitchen.
Red Hot World Buffet in Liverpool One shopping centre was also ordered to pay £7,816 costs after admitting breaching health and safety regulations.
Owners Passepartouts Ltd pleaded guilty to 10 counts at Liverpool Magistrates’ Court after mice droppings and beetle larvae were found during an inspection.
The restaurant closed in June and the owners are now in administration.

Environmental health officers visited the restaurant twice last year.
Live mice were caught on sticky traps and mouse droppings and grease were found next to food containers and near fridges.
